Next items on the order are:-
Tempura Hand Roll

- look quite sad and the seaweed dont even seem to hold the rice inside (Not recommended)

Soft Shell Crab Sushi Roll
- a huge disappointment. Cant even taste the crab. (Not recommended)

Sashimi - for 2-3 people
(if budget is a constraint, just try the salmon sashimi cos thats the best)

Grilled Wagyu Beef - 100g
(REALLY AWESOME!!! A MUST TRY although the price is a bit of a killer)
